
A DPF reading 400 per cent full: Mercedes A200 diesel
A Stourbridge customer brought this one in with a simple complaint: no power. The diagnostics gave a less simple answer. The diesel particulate filter was reading 400 per cent full, and that is not a number everyday driving produces. The exhaust temperature sensor that should have been managing the burn-off was dead, so the filter had blocked solid.
Rather than a new filter, the customer chose a secondhand unit that we had professionally cleaned, which saved a good deal of money. That went on with a new lambda sensor and a new exhaust temperature sensor, every fault code was cleared, and a road test confirmed it. Running perfectly.
